Webb6 apr. 2024 · Inherent risks (IR) are vulnerabilities within an organization before a set of controls or auditing procedures have been implemented. IR management is a large part of enterprise risk management, which examines an entire company’s risk factors that could disrupt business operations and cause financial losses.
Webb12 apr. 2024 · Risks in Auditing Revenues: Revenue audit is often considered to be a high-risk process in the company because the inherent risk is mostly high when it comes to revenue. This is primarily because several complex transactions are included in the revenue recognition.
